Optimizing The Application with NVMe Cloud Infrastructure
For companies demanding optimal agility, the shift to NVMe cloud hosting represents a substantial advantage. Traditional SATA solid-state drives (SSDs) have long been a step up from mechanical hard drives, but NVMe (Non-Volatile Memory Express) takes things to another level. NVMe drives leverage the PCIe interface, bypassing the bottlenecks inherent in older protocols, resulting in drastically faster latency and higher input/output operations per second (IOPS). This translates directly to improved application loading times, superior visitor journey, and an overall more dynamic virtual identity. Consider NVMe for mission-critical applications and data-intensive workloads seeking the best in hosted performance.
